Initiative announces annual funding call for pilot research grants
The Population Health Initiative seeks to create a world where all people can live healthier and more fulfilling lives. In support of that vision, the initiative is pleased to announce its funding call to 91探花 faculty and PI-eligible research scientists for population health pilot research grants of up to $50,000 each. Applications for this round of funding are due on Wednesday, February 6, 2019.
These grants are intended to encourage the development of new interdisciplinary collaborations among investigators for projects that address critical components of different聽grand challenges the 91探花 seeks to address in population health. Faculty members and PI-eligible research scientists from all three 91探花campuses (Bothell, Seattle, Tacoma) are encouraged to apply.
